›Chia seeds are small, oval-shaped seeds that come from the Salvia hispanica plant.
These tiny seeds are rich in nutrients and are often called a superfood. They are packed with fiber, protein, omega-3 fatty acids, and important minerals like calcium and magnesium. To get the best out of chia seeds, soaking them in liquid is highly recommended.
Why Soak Chia Seeds
Soaking chia seeds is important because of how they behave when mixed with liquids. These seeds can absorb up to 10 times their weight in water. When soaked, they turn into a gel-like substance. This makes them easier to eat and digest. It also helps your body absorb the nutrients better. Eating dry chia seeds may lead to discomfort, as they may expand in your stomach and cause bloating or gas.
Ideal Soaking Time
The best time to soak chia seeds is for at least 20 minutes. This gives the seeds enough time to absorb water and form a gel. If you have more time, soaking them for 1 to 2 hours is even better. Some people prefer to soak them overnight for a smoother texture, especially when adding them to puddings or drinks. However, soaking them for more than 12 hours is not necessary, and after 5 days they should be discarded if not used.
How to Soak Chia Seeds
Soaking chia seeds is very simple. Take 1 tablespoon of chia seeds and mix it with ½ cup of water or any liquid like milk, juice, or coconut water. Stir the mixture well and let it sit. Stir again after a few minutes to prevent clumping. After soaking, the seeds should look like a thick gel. You can store this in a covered container in the fridge for up to 5 days. Soaked chia seeds can be added to smoothies, yogurt, oatmeal, or used as an egg substitute in baking.
Benefits of Soaked Chia Seeds
Soaked chia seeds offer many health benefits. They help with hydration, support digestion, and give a feeling of fullness. This can help with weight control. The fiber in the seeds also helps keep blood sugar levels stable. The omega-3 fatty acids support heart and brain health. Because they swell up and slow down digestion, they keep you full for longer periods of time.
